Amazon's acquisition of MGM gives them creative control over the James Bond franchise. The next film, Bond 26, is set to hit theaters by late 2027 with a budget of £250m. Producers are currently searching for the actor to replace Daniel Craig.

Analysis of New James Bond Film Release and Market Implications

Key Facts and Data Points

  • Release Date: The next James Bond film (Bond 26) is expected to hit cinemas by the end of 2027.
  • Budget: The film has a budget of £250m, matching the budget of Daniel Craig’s final outing No Time to Die.
  • Production Timeline: Production began after being fast-tracked following Amazon’s $1bn acquisition of MGM.
  • Creative Control: Amazon now holds full creative control over future Bond productions, despite Michael G. Wilson and Barbara Broccoli remaining co-owners.

Market Trends and Business Impact

  • Longest Wait for a Bond Film: The 2027 release will set a new record for the longest wait between Bond films (matching the gap between Dr No in 1962 and GoldenEye in 1995).
  • Spin-offs and Franchise Expansion: Amazon plans to explore spin-offs, signaling an intent to expand the franchise’s reach beyond traditional films.

Competitive Dynamics

  • New Bond Actor Search: Potential replacements for Daniel Craig include Aaron Taylor-Johnson, Harris Dickinson, and James Norton.
  • Creative Shifts: The involvement of David Heyman (Harry Potter) and Amy Pascal (Spider-Man) suggests a pivot toward more commercially oriented storytelling.
